We recently submitted the negotiation result for a new collective labor agreement for Metal and Technology, with a positive recommendation, to the members of De Unie in the sector. Our members had until February 20, 2026, to cast their votes. Voting has now closed. Many members cast their votes, thank you!

Members agree!
We are pleased to announce that the vast majority of members who voted supported the negotiated outcome. The comments made show that our members are particularly pleased with the new agreement regarding additional vacation hours for older employees. Finally, this arrangement will be implemented as our members desired. The accrual of additional vacation hours will remain in effect until the state pension age.
Our members are also satisfied with the two-year term of the new collective labor agreement, as this contributes to peace and stability within the sector.
Critical comments
Of course, there were also critical comments, particularly regarding the wage increase. Our members would have preferred a full percentage increase. The way wage increases are currently applied (a combination of a percentage increase and a nominal amount) will have a leveling effect.
How further?
After the votes of the other unions and employers have been completed, a final agreement on the new collective labor agreement for the Metal and Technology sector will be reached. This is expected around the second week of March. We will inform our members when this happens.
